African Mango: A Natural Weight Loss Supplement?

If you're looking for a natural way to lose weight, you may have heard of African mango. This fruit, native to Cameroon, is said to have several properties that can help with weight loss. But what does the research say?

African mango is a good source of fiber. Fiber is important for weight loss because it helps you feel full and satisfied after eating, which can lead to eating less overall. In addition, fiber can help to regulate blood sugar levels and reduce cholesterol levels.

Some studies have shown that African mango may also help to boost metabolism. Metabolism is the process by which your body converts food into energy. When your metabolism is working properly, you burn more calories, even at rest.

African mango may also help to reduce inflammation. Inflammation is a major risk factor for obesity and other chronic diseases. By reducing inflammation, African mango may help to protect against these conditions.

One study found that people who took African mango extract for 12 weeks lost an average of 8.5 pounds more than people who took a placebo. The African mango group also had significant reductions in body fat and waist circumference.

Another study found that people who took African mango extract for 10 weeks lost an average of 5.2 pounds more than people who took a placebo. The African mango group also had significant reductions in body mass index (BMI) and body fat percentage.

Overall, the research suggests that African mango may be a safe and effective natural weight loss supplement. However, it's important to note that more research is needed to confirm the long-term safety and efficacy of African mango.
